How a Thermal Fluid System Operates
A thermal oil boiler system circulates a high-temperature fluid through a closed loop. The fluid is heated in the boiler and then pumped to process equipment like reactors, dryers, or presses, where it releases its heat before returning to be reheated. This closed-circuit design minimizes heat loss and operates at low pressure, even at very high temperatures, reducing system stress and safety risks.
Key Advantages and Industrial Uses
The primary benefit is high-temperature efficiency at low pressure. This makes them ideal for industries such as chemical processing, asphalt production, and textile manufacturing. Other critical applications include indirect heating for food processing and thermal oil heating for composite molding. Their precision and reliability support continuous, energy-efficient operations.
Selecting the Right High-Temperature Boiler
Choosing a system requires careful analysis. Key factors are your required operating temperature range, heat load capacity, and fuel type (gas, oil, electric). Consider the thermal fluid’s degradation point and the system’s overall thermal efficiency. A well-sized system ensures long-term performance and cost savings.
Maximizing System Performance and Longevity
Routine maintenance is crucial. This includes regular analysis of the thermal fluid quality, checking pump seals, and cleaning the heater coils. Proper maintenance prevents carbon buildup and fluid breakdown, sustaining optimal heat transfer efficiency and extending the system’s service life.
Frequently Asked Questions
Q: What is the maximum temperature a thermal oil boiler can achieve?
A: Systems can efficiently reach temperatures up to 600°F (315°C) and higher with specialized fluids, far exceeding the practical limit of saturated steam systems.
Q: Are these systems safer than steam boilers?
A: Yes. Operating at low pressure eliminates the risks associated with high-pressure steam, making them a safer choice for high-temperature processes.
Q: What industries benefit most from this technology?
A: They are essential in oil & gas, chemical manufacturing, asphalt plants, and any industry requiring precise, high-temperature indirect heating.
